turbo rsx, return fuel line or no?
my neighbor is looking at getting a kit for his daily driver. 03 rsx. i dont know much about k series
i noticed some people were saying you had to add a return fuel line. and some say you dont.
if he were to go w/ a regular revhard kit and say some 750s and kpro. does he need to run a fuel return line or not?

Nope he'll be fine with moderate boost levels. The returnless fuel system seems to become inefective at 400 + hp. This is of course injector and fuel pump dependant.
